This 4 CD set celebrates the 100th anniversary of the premiere of Stravinskys ballet The Rite of Spring in Paris on 29 May 1913. It is widely regarded as the most significant event in 20th century classical music and the shock of this groundbreaking score can still be felt today. Included in this outstanding collection are six of the greatest recordings ever made of the work from the catalogues of Decca, Deutsche Grammophon and Philips. In addition to digital recordings by Antal Dorati, Riccardo Chailly, Pierre Boulez, Valery Gergiev and Esa-Pekka Salonen, is a recording from 1956 by Pierre Monteux, the conductor of the premiere on that fateful night in 1913. Also included on the fourth CD is Jon Tolanskys illuminating audio documentary that includes the first ever issue of first hand, eye-witness recollections of the legendary premiere, and specially recorded comments on the works revolutionary power from international conductors, choreographers and dancers.
